2. Information We Collect

2.1 Your Reflections Stay on Your Device

The reflections, prayers, and answers you write in the App are stored only on your device, in local app storage. They are not uploaded to Foundry, to Dr. Claire, or to any third party. If you use the export feature, the App opens your own mail composer with your entries so you can send them wherever you choose; nothing is sent until you press send in your mail app.

2.2 Sign In Information

When you sign in with Apple or Google, the App receives your email address, your name if you choose to share it, and an account identifier. In the current version this information is stored on your device to keep you signed in. If a future version introduces secure cloud backup of your entries, your account will be used to protect and restore your data, and this policy will be updated first.

2.3 Reminders

If you set a daily reminder, the App schedules a local notification on your device at the time you choose. No notification tokens are sent to any server, and the App cannot send you remote push messages.

2.4 Analytics and Diagnostics

PostHog receives an app-specific identifier, account identifier after sign-in, device and app details, screens viewed, taps, app lifecycle events, onboarding, charge-completion and paywall events, crash and error details, and masked session replay. Text inputs, images, and sandboxed views are masked. We do not send the words of your reflections or prayers as analytics event properties. The App has no advertising and does not access your camera, photos, microphone, contacts, or precise location.

2.5 Subscription Information

RevenueCat and the applicable app store process purchase, entitlement, renewal, and restore information. Foundry does not receive your full payment-card number.

2.6 Support Requests

If you email us for help, we receive your email address and whatever you include in the message. We use it only to respond to you.
